Output 25501bedacb90bb3d09d60d626023e514b018f1c79ed8a97ccfaf764747d2dd6:0

value
21142300
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 580954a1b384f557f78b33de3200154c05ed0a58 OP_EQUALVERIFY OP_CHECKSIG
address
192VeBZFNd5z1noRkiXFL1zkW5D3NVKk8u
transaction
25501bedacb90bb3d09d60d626023e514b018f1c79ed8a97ccfaf764747d2dd6
confirmations
613154
spent
true